Visão geral -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P 2020 vs Honda CBR1000RR Fireblade 2012
The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P 2020 is a supersport motorcycle that boasts an incredibly powerful engine with 217 HP and 113 Nm of torque. Its inline four-cylinder engine has a displacement of 999.89 ccm and a compression ratio of 13. The bike features a DOHC valve system with four valves per cylinder.
In terms of suspension, the Fireblade SP is equipped with electronically adjustable Öhlins suspension both at the front and rear. The front suspension is a telescopic upside-down fork, while the rear suspension offers compression, preload, and rebound adjustment.
The chassis of the Fireblade SP is made of aluminum and features a twin-spar frame design. The bike is equipped with dual disc brakes at the front, utilizing radial monobloc technology for enhanced braking performance.
One of the standout features of the Fireblade SP is its advanced rider assistance systems. These include electronically adjustable suspension, multiple riding modes, cornering ABS, launch control, ride-by-wire throttle, quick shifter, traction control, and anti-wheelie control.

In terms of dimensions, the Fireblade SP has a front tire width of 120 mm and a rear tire width of 200 mm. The bike has a wheelbase of 1455 mm and a seat height of 830 mm. The curb weight, including ABS, is 201 kg, and the fuel tank has a capacity of 16.1 liters.
On the other hand, the Honda CBR1000RR Fireblade 2012 is also a supersport motorcycle but with slightly less power, offering 178 HP and 112 Nm of torque. The inline four-cylinder engine has a displacement of 999.8 ccm and a compression ratio of 12.3. It also features a DOHC valve system with four valves per cylinder.
The suspension setup of the Fireblade 2012 is similar to the Fireblade SP, with a telescopic upside-down fork at the front and compression, preload, and rebound adjustment at the rear. The chassis is made of aluminum and features a twin-tube frame design.
In terms of braking, the Fireblade 2012 is equipped with dual disc brakes at the front, utilizing radial monobloc technology. It also features ABS for enhanced safety.

The bike has a front tire width of 120 mm and a rear tire width of 190 mm. The wheelbase is slightly shorter at 1407 mm, and the seat height is 820 mm. The curb weight, including ABS, is slightly higher at 211 kg, and the fuel tank has a larger capacity of 17.7 liters.
While both bikes are supersport motorcycles, the Fireblade SP 2020 offers several advancements over the Fireblade 2012. It has a more powerful engine, advanced electronic rider assistance systems, and adjustable Öhlins suspension. However, it should be noted that the transmission and power delivery of the Fireblade SP are primarily designed for the racetrack, and it lacks cruise control.
On the other hand, the Fireblade 2012 offers a simpler chassis design, a comfortable riding position, and ABS. However, it may have some unusual configuration issues with balance and handlebar precision.
In conclusion, the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P 2020 is a highly advanced and powerful supersport motorcycle, while the Honda CBR1000RR Fireblade 2012 offers a more straightforward and comfortable riding experience.

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P 2020

Os fãs exigiram-na e a Honda cumpriu: A nova CBR1000RR Fireblade SP é a Blade mais desportiva de sempre. Pela primeira vez, ela agora tem um foco claro na pista de corrida. Muitos dos seus pontos fortes, como o comportamento maravilhosamente estável e direto ou o desempenho de travagem, também podem ser explorados na estrada rural. Mas especialmente no capítulo do motor, a Honda seguiu um caminho claro: sem compromissos, a potência e o tempo por volta estão em primeiro lugar. Isto reflecte-se sobretudo no facto de, abaixo das 6000 rotações, a potência ser bastante reduzida, o que, por sua vez, não é o ideal na estrada rural. Mas se isso não o incomoda, ficará satisfeito com a nova Fireblade. A Honda não correu riscos e simplesmente trouxe os melhores parceiros para a SP: Akrapovic, Öhlins e Brembo foram os parceiros de confiança da equipa Honda. Naturalmente, todos estes componentes também têm um preço correspondente.
